从命令行美化编译 C++

Prettify compiling C++ from Command Line

我正在尝试通过 VS 2017 编译器(vsvarsall.bat 设置)从本机 Windows CMD 编译 C++。

有什么方法可以减少 cl 命令的输出,例如 Microsoft 对编译器和链接器的限制?

此外,题外话:是否可以使用 UNICODE 或 ANSI 字符串编译代码(就像我能够从 Visual Studio IDE 构建),还是我必须使用手册 #defines?

关于您的第一个问题,请参阅 /nologo compiler flag

我猜第二个原因是人们投票赞成关闭的原因——处理 ANSI/Unicode 字符串的方法有很多种,如果没有更多地定义您真正想要的东西,机会很差,任何人都可以给出有意义的答案。